As a Yearbook Staff member, your responsibilities will include:
o Designing a yearbook, including photos, captions, layouts, editing, proofing, and graphic design.
o Being responsible for your pages and layouts, including meeting deadlines and time management.
o Attending school events (before, during, and after school) to take photos and sell yearbooks.
o Selling ads this summer to businesses to support the production of the yearbook.
*****Students are required to sell at least $250 worth of ads by October 1, 2020. If the student sells the full amount, his or her yearbook is free. If the student sells less than the full amount, his or her yearbook cost will be proportionate to the amount of ads the student did sell. If no ads are sold, the student will be responsible for the full cost of his or her yearbook and for participating in any additional fundraisers during the year. Ad sales also count as a major grade during the first quarter.
